Architect
Responsibilities
- Research, plan, assess and design a variety of building projects
- Provide technical guidance and coordinate with the technical team, including civil, structural, mechanical, electrical, and fire protection engineering
- Work with the project team to prepare presentations and produce documents from schematic design through to the construction phase
- Conduct and document site visits, process submittals, substitution requests, and RFI’s during construction
Requirements
-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Architecture or Architectural Engineering
- 5-10 years of project experience in an architectural practice
- Working knowledge of building codes, standards, building construction, and building structures
- Proficient in current version of AutoCAD and/or Revit
- Strong leadership, organizational, communication and relationship management skills
- Architectural Registration (any State)
